CVE-2024-37085 — VMware ESXi Authentication Bypass Vulnerability

Severity: Critical · Kind: Vulnerability

VMware ESXi. VMware ESXi contains an authentication bypass vulnerability. A malicious actor with sufficient Active Directory (AD) permissions can gain full access to an ESXi host that was previously configured to use AD for user management by re-creating the configured AD group ('ESXi Admins' by default) after it was deleted from AD. Required action: Apply mitigations per vendor instructions or discontinue use of the product if mitigations are unavailable.
